If you've ever added a server to a cache cluster and watched your database melt, you already know the problem consistent hashing solves. You just might not know it by name. I built a full implementation from scratch in Go to understand it deeply. This post walks through what I learned — the problem, the fix, and the gotchas nobody tells you about.
